Rama: A Man of Dharma
Although Valmiki’s Ramayana has been enjoyed for millennia, it is not widely known that it is the oldest existing piece of literature in the world.
This translation of Valmiki’s Ramayana, Rama: A Man of Dharma, is a compelling read while remaining true to the original work. It brings Valmiki’s ancient Sanskrit epic to you in lucid English without diluting the poet’s intent.
Read this book and be amazed at the high thinking of our ancestors. The values we cherish today―democracy, liberty, equality and justice―are core to this story. Rama is an embodiment of the type of righteousness that never loses relevance, making him a man who is a role model in every age
Life Is A Battlefield
Like Arjuna, every human being must navigate the battlefield of life, so the Gita speaks to us all, providing invaluable coping skills to handle adversities that inevitably arise along the way. In this book, Priya Arora clubs together verses that have a common theme or concept, such as the power of focus and how actions have consequences, and goes on to explain the instructions that the Gita offers on how to handle these situations. She contextualizes the verse and explains what the takeaway is meant to be. The Gita’s spiritual teachings are forever pertinent because they are not born of the social constraints or moral conventions of a particular time in history. Instead, Krishna shows the path to overcoming suffering by adopting the right attitude to adversity. This wonderful interpretation and explanation of the Gita shows the abiding relevance of Krishna’s instruction in our lives today.
